  • 5. What do we mean? • zero hours / casual contract • fixed term contract / temporary.
  • 6. Worker or employee? Employee; • a contract • work must be done by that person • mutuality • control • other terms consistent with employment. It’s the reality of the relationship that determines whether someone is a worker or an employee
  • 8. What is a zero hours contract? • a contract for casual working • employer does not guarantee to provide work • worker is expected to be available for work if needed • worker is paid for the actual work that is done.

  • 10. Zero hours Four key areas for concern • exclusivity clauses • lack of transparency • uncertainty of earnings • balance of power.
  • 11. Coming soon… • Small Business, Enterprise and Employment Bill 2014-2015 (SBEEB) • will prohibit exclusivity clauses.

  • 15. Do’s and don’ts Do • use them where there is a genuine need for a casual arrangement • be clear with workers that they can turn work down • review the arrangements regularly. Don’t • use exclusivity clauses • leave people on them for years and years • assume that they can be ended without notice • allow a mutuality of obligation to become established.
  • 17. What are they? • contracts for employment that are for limited periods of time • end could be specified in the contract or be triggered by a specified event.

Uses • maternity cover • sickness absence cover • cover for other types of employee absence • specific external funding which may not be renewed (SEN) • possibility or restructuring or redundancy in the near future • special project • need for a particular post is not clear so trial period is used before committing to a permanent position.
  • 19. Successive use Fixed term employees who have been continuously employed for: • two years have the right to not be unfairly dismissed and will be entitled to a redundancy payment if made redundant • four years are deemed to be permanent employees.
  • 20. Ending the contract End date is; a. specified in contract b. triggered by a particular event c. earlier than specified date d. due to redundancy. If contract is not renewed this is a dismissal.

Dos and don’ts Do • think carefully at the outset when drafting the contract: • why is it a fixed term? • what is the notice period? • if you are renewing it, consider why and confirm in writing. Don’t • let contracts drift • use a fixed term contract if the need is a permanent one • assume that the contract can just expire.
  • 27. What is it? A period at the start of an employment relationship during which the employee is assessed by their employer and following which time they are notified as to whether their appointment will be made permanent.
  • 28. What do I need? • contract • procedure • review process.
  • 29. Things to consider • length of probation • reviewer • frequency of reviews • standards and expectations • information that you will use to assess.
  • 30. Things to consider • performance in role • conduct, behaviour and attitude • attendance.

Keeping the employee informed • make sure employee knows that job is subject to probation • make sure you have communicated your expectations • ensure that employee knows what the process is • provide regular feedback during the probation period • keep records of meetings and provide copies to employee.
  • 32. Confirm, extend or end? The purpose of the probation period is to assess suitability for the role. At some point you will need to decide whether to: 1. confirm employment 2. extend the probation period 3. end employment.
  • 33. Confirm, extend or end? Jeremy has been employed by you for three months as an Attendance Officer. He has had experience in a previous school. Jeremy is very enthusiastic, but does not carry out his role in the way you would like him to. He doesn’t follow the systems that are in place in the school and his colleagues have complained that this is causing problems. To date Jeremy has made little impact on improving the attendance figures. In addition he is often late for work and has had two weeks absence already. You are due to review his probation, how would you approach this and would you confirm, extend or end?
  • 34. Absence during probation This could be due to: • sickness • disability • maternity or adoption leave. Consider each case on its facts. Don’t automatically regard the attendance as unsatisfactory Consider an extension to the probation period.
  • 35. Dos and don’ts Do • use probation periods • have relevant clause in the contract • give regular and constructive feedback • ensure that you make a decision before the end of the period • extend if necessary. Don’t • let period expire without a decision • allow periods to extend over two years.
